KEY RESPONSIBILITIES Legal Support

Prepare and organize filings for USCIS, EOIR, and state courts

Assist with drafting legal correspondence, declarations, and case summaries

Organize supporting evidence and documentation for filings

Maintain accurate case files and track deadlines

Translate documents and client statements between Spanish and English

Client Communication

Assist with client intake and information gathering

Communicate with Spanish-speaking clients regarding documents and case progress

Maintain professional and organized client files

Office Operations

Assist with scheduling, case tracking, and document organization

Maintain digital and physical filing systems

Support the attorney with administrative and operational tasks

Help ensure the office runs efficiently on a daily basis
